Ten Minutes Older: The Cello DVD Summary
Eight master directors of world cinema combine forces for this omnibus film that focuses cumulatively on the subject of time.
Bookended by cello interludes,
Ten Minutes Older: The Cello
presents just one parameter to each of its filmmakers: no final entry can be more or less than ten minutes long.
The resulting films run the gamut of styles and moods, beginning with
Bernardo Bertolucci
's
Histoire d'Eaux
, which presents an Indian fable about a mentor's impatience.
